The earlier a puppy is introduced to grooming, the more confident and happy they’ll feel as they grow. Our Puppy Intro Pack offers a gentle, three-session experience designed to build trust and help your puppy enjoy the salon as a fun and welcoming place.
Session One – A gentle first step
Your puppy will explore the salon, meet the team and get used to all the new tools, sounds, and smells. We’ll introduce them to the grooming table and let them experience the feel of clippers, brushes, and dryers in a calm and playful setting, with plenty of cuddles and treats.
Session Two – A soft introduction to grooming
During this visit, your puppy will enjoy their first bath and fluff dry. Table training continues alongside a gentle introduction to grooming. Everything is done at your puppy’s pace to keep each visit positive and enjoyable.
Session Three – The big day
Now comfortable with the salon and our team, your puppy is ready for their first full groom of your choice. We take the time needed to ensure the experience remains relaxed and enjoyable, helping them develop a positive, lifelong association with grooming.

Puppies can begin once they have completed their full course of vaccinations, usually around 8 weeks old, and up to 5 months of age. This helps ensure they’re healthy and ready to enjoy their new experiences.
The first two sessions are 2 hours each. The final session may be longer depending on the breed, as a full groom can often take more than 2 hours, especially for hand-stripping breeds.
The first two sessions are booked one week apart, with the full groom scheduled two weeks after the second session.
We do our best to organise small groups of up to four puppies to go through the process together. This allows them to learn from each other and, most importantly, enjoy plenty of playful puppy interactions. Group sessions depend on receiving multiple requests around the same time and owners being available on matching days and times.
After the last session, we will review how the full groom went in terms of behaviour and note any feedback you provide about their new look. We will also discuss a grooming schedule tailored to your puppy’s breed, coat type, and lifestyle, and answer any questions you have about maintaining their coat at home.
